    The Buffalo Bandits averaged better regular season attendance than 22 of 32 NHL teams and 17 of 30 NBA teams.
    Average NLL Attendance By Team During The 2024-25 Season: Buffalo Bandits: 18,471 Calgary Roughnecks: 12,087 Colorado Mammoth: 9,875 Halifax Thunderbirds: 9,789 Vancouver Warriors: 9,677 Philadelphia Wings: 6,830 Saskatchewan Rush: 6,572 Rochester Knighthawks: 5,456 Ottawa Black
